Diego Ruiz, Torrey Pines (CA), 2025 Positional Profile: SS/OF Body: 5-9, 140-pounds. Hit: RHH. Open stance, bat resting on the shoulder, knees slightly bent. Small load and a stride straight forward. Good line drives to both sides. Hard swinger. 65.7 mph bat speed with 9 G's of rotational acceleration. Power: 87 max exit velocity, averaged 81.3 mph. 312' max distance. Arm: RH. INF-72 mph. OF-80 mph. ATH: 7.18 runner in the 60. 1.74 and 4.02 in the 10 and 30 yard splits. 25.40 max vertical.
